    Lorne Hyman Greene OC (born Lyon Himan Green; 12 February 1915 – 11 September 1987) was a Canadian actor, musician, singer and radio personality. His notable television roles include Ben Cartwright on the Western Bonanza and Commander Adama in the original science-fiction television series Battlestar Galactica and Galactica 1980 .

  10. Greene, Lorne (1915-1987) One of the most famous Canadian-born actors ever, Greene got his start on the stage at Queen's. Greene was a native of Ottawa. He entered Queen's in 1932 to study Chemical Engineering, then joined the University's Drama Guild and switched his major to languages ( French and German) so he could have more time for theatre.
